Highlights
Are people in Johnson City older or younger than people in Spruce Pine?
- The Median Age in Johnson City is 10.0 years younger than in Spruce Pine.

Are housing costs cheaper in Johnson City or Spruce Pine?
- Johnson City housing costs are 8.1% more expensive than Spruce Pine hous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Johnson City or Spruce Pine?
- The average commute for residents of Johnson City is 7.6 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Spruce Pine.

Things to do in Spruce Pine?
Living in Spruce Pine, NC is a unique experience. The small town of less than 2,000 people is peaceful and serene, with an abundance of natural beauty to explore. The surrounding forests offer a variety of outdoor activities such as hiking and fishing, while the downtown area boasts a range of local businesses and restaurants. Residents enjoy the small-town feel in which everyone knows each other and there is always something to do. There's something special about living in such a close-knit community where people are always looking out for one another, promoting positive relationships among neighbors.

Things to do in Johnson City?
Johnson City, Tennessee is a vibrant city located in eastern Tennessee. This wonderful city offers plenty of attractions for visitors to explore, such as the historic downtown area or the breathtaking Doe River Gorge. Residents here also enjoy some great outdoor recreation opportunities at Buffalo Mountain Park or Winged Deer Park. With its strong economy, stunning views, and diverse range of activities, it's no wonder why so many people choose to call Johnson City their home!
